SCHEDULE: Vanguard Amends Materion Stake, Cites Internal Realignment
Beneficial Ownership Report Amendment
The Vanguard Group updated its beneficial ownership in Materion Corp, reporting an 11.3% stake following an internal realignment that shifts portfolio management and proxy voting responsibilities to subsidiaries.
Summary
- The Vanguard Group reported beneficial ownership of 2,344,101 shares of Materion Corp common stock.
- This represents 11.3% of the class of securities.
- Vanguard holds shared voting power over 162,647 shares and shared dispositive power over all 2,344,101 shares.
- An internal realignment occurred at The Vanguard Group, Inc. on January 12, 2026.
- Post-realignment, The Vanguard Group, Inc. no longer performs portfolio management services or administers proxy voting.
- Certain subsidiaries or business divisions will now report beneficial ownership separately.
- These subsidiaries will continue to pursue the same investment strategies.

Key Dates
| Date | Description |
|---|---|
| 01/12/1998 | Date of SEC Release No. 34-39538, referenced for disaggregated reporting. |
| 12/31/2025 | Date of event requiring the filing of this statement. |
| 01/12/2026 | Date of The Vanguard Group, Inc.'s internal realignment, ceasing portfolio management and proxy voting services. |
| 01/30/2026 | Date the Schedule 13G/A was signed by The Vanguard Group. |
